Publication number: 20260168584Abstract: A piston check valve system includes a body including an upstream end and a downstream end, a bonnet secured to a proximal opening of the body, and a piston secured within the body, the piston being moveable between a closed position in which the piston rests upon a valve seat and an open position in which the piston is spaced away from the valve seat. The piston check valve system also includes a retainer configured to guide and retain the piston and to secure the valve seat within the body.Type: ApplicationFiled: January 28, 2026Publication date: June 18, 2026Applicant: SCV Valve, LLCInventor: Sidney MCCARRA

Publication number: 20260085760Abstract: A ball valve may include a body having an upstream end and a downstream end. A ball may be within the body between the two ends, the ball being rotatable about a vertical axis to move between an open position and a closed position. A ball valve may include a stem with a body and an actuator portion that enables the ball to be rotated between the open and closed positions. A ball valve may include a seat assembly with a first end facing towards the ball and a second end facing away from the ball, the seat assembly including a seat, the seat being in contact with the ball; a lantern ring, the lantern ring positioned closer to the second end of the seat assembly than the first end of the seat assembly; and a seal, the seal positioned between the seat and the lantern ring.Type: ApplicationFiled: December 4, 2025Publication date: March 26, 2026Applicant: SCV Valve, LLCInventor: Sidney MCCARRA

Publication number: 20260063213Abstract: A swing check valve includes a body and a swing assembly, the body including an inner volume having a middle portion extending between an upstream end portion and a downstream end portion and a wall that surrounds the inner volume and the swing assembly including a disc having an upstream surface that faces the upstream end portion when the disc is in a closed position and a downstream surface that faces the downstream end portion when the disc is in the closed position and a valve seat having an outer circumferential surface in contact with the wall. The body also includes a flow path extending from the upstream end portion to the downstream end portion, wherein the middle portion includes the flow path and an upper recess positioned above the flow path.Type: ApplicationFiled: November 7, 2025Publication date: March 5, 2026Applicant: SCV Valve, LLCInventor: Sidney MCCARRA

Publication number: 20250377043Abstract: A gate valve system may include a downstream end and an upstream end with a flow path extending through the downstream end and the upstream end. A gate valve system may include a gate extending within the body with a downstream surface facing the downstream end and an upstream surface facing the upstream end. A gate valve system may include a stem secured to the gate and configured to actuate the gate between a first position in which a flow of fluid is permitted between the downstream end and the upstream end and a second position in which the flow of fluid is prevented. A gate valve system may include a downstream seat assembly contacting the downstream surface and an upstream seat assembly contacting the upstream surface, wherein each of the downstream seat assembly and the upstream seat assembly includes a spring member.Type: ApplicationFiled: June 6, 2024Publication date: December 11, 2025Applicant: SCV Valve, LLCInventor: Sidney MCCARRA

Publication number: 20240369144Abstract: A ball valve system includes a body having an upstream end and a downstream end and a ball within the body between the upstream end and the downstream end, the ball being rotatable about a vertical axis to move between a closed position and an open position. The ball valve assembly includes a stem movable in an actuation direction substantially parallel to the vertical axis, the stem including a recess at a proximal portion of the stem, a guiding member extending within the recess of the stem, the guiding member being configured to prevent rotation of the stem or cause rotation of the stem, and a lubrication port in fluid communication with the recess.Type: ApplicationFiled: July 17, 2024Publication date: November 7, 2024Applicant: SCV Valve, LLCInventor: Sidney MCCARRA

Publication number: 20230213101Abstract: A gate valve system includes a body including an upstream end, a downstream end, and a flow path extending through the upstream end and the downstream end. The gate valve system includes a gate assembly extending within the body, the gate assembly including a gate a stem secured to the gate and configured to place the expandable gate in a first position in which a flow of fluid is permitted between the upstream end and the downstream end and a second position in which the flow of fluid is prevented. The gate valve system also includes a lubrication port in an exterior of the body, the lubrication port being in fluid communication with an interior of the body and including a lubrication guiding insert configured to guide a supply of lubricating fluid to a location inside the body and between the upstream end and the downstream end.Type: ApplicationFiled: March 9, 2023Publication date: July 6, 2023Applicant: SCV Valve, LLCInventor: Sidney MCCARRA
